| Aspect | Wastewater Project Engineer | Civil Engineer |
|---|
| Credentials | Bachelor's in Environmental or Civil Engineering, PE license often preferred | Bachelor's in Civil Engineering, PE license common |
| Work Environment | Design, oversee wastewater treatment projects, field inspections | Design and oversee various infrastructure projects, including roads, bridges, water systems |
| Industry Usage | Primarily in water/wastewater treatment facilities and environmental firms | Broad industry, including construction, transportation, and water resources |
Wastewater Project Engineers focus specifically on wastewater treatment projects, requiring specialized knowledge in water systems. Civil Engineers have a broader scope, working on various infrastructure projects. Both roles require similar credentials and often work within the same industry, but their project focus differs significantly.
